Phoenix McDonald's shooting: Teen employee killed following argument; suspect turns himself in to police
The shooting happened at 51st Avenue and Baseline Road around 10:15 a.m. on March 2, says Phoenix Police Sgt. Vincent Cole. Investigators say the suspect, identified as 16-year-old Christopher Track, shot and killed 16-year-old Prince Nedd after they got into a fight in the restroom.
